Output 56addbf3ece8a60684fa066eb3f861c55fe6af2d9bb94236f5c8aef16da15d0b:0

value
632376
script pubkey
OP_0 OP_PUSHBYTES_20 c638def168359816ebbf1d71d81529ddda1244ef
address
bc1qccudautgxkvpd6alr4cas9ffmhdpy380wle75p
transaction
56addbf3ece8a60684fa066eb3f861c55fe6af2d9bb94236f5c8aef16da15d0b
confirmations
148315
spent
true